 The Parish Council met on Thursday 8th August 2019 at the Drax Hall. 11 members
 th
 of the public were present. The next meeting will be on Thursday 12  September
 at the Drax Hall, starting at 7pm. All parishioners are very welcome to attend and
 to  take  the  opportunity  to  raise  any  matters  or  concerns  at  the  start  of  the
 meeting.


 Planning Applications
 The  parish  council  considered  two  planning  applications  that  had  attracted
 public  interest,  some  of  whom  were  in  attendance  at  the  council  meeting  to
 comment.

 The council voted to object to application 6/2019/0273 for the erection of a new
 dwelling in the beer garden at the Drax Arms on the basis that, contrary to what
 was stated in the application,  the beer garden is still in beneficial use; the Drax
 Arms  has  been  listed  as  a  community  asset  in  the  recently  adopted
 neighbourhood plan; the scale of the proposed dwelling is considered to be out
 of  keeping  with  the  site  and  surroundings,  while;  visibility  and  access  to  the
 parking area is considered to be inadequate. Neighbours and users of the Drax
 Arms are encouraged to make their own representations to Dorset Council.

 The  council  voted  not  to  object  to  application  6/2019/0372  at  1  Shitterton.  This
 application seeks to regularise the existing planning situation, which comprises a
 mixed-use situation with a dwelling-house with garden, land and commercial. The
 parish  council  were  satisfied  that  these  activities  have  been  carried  out  for  a
 period in excess of 10 years. If approved by Dorset Council the consent will not
 allow for any intensification of use.
